I picked up this trade card at the Valley Forge show yesterday. It's a stock card that printed the advertiser's information in the blank space between the bat and catcher's mask/bats. The card measures 4 3/8" X 7 3/8" and is printed on heavier stock. It was produced in 1886 by Ketterlinus Lithographers, one of Philadelphia's premier printers/lithographers of the late 19th/early 20th century. The baseball scene on this card was a stock depiction for Ketterlinus and is identified by the number 2217 beneath the ball.
